Multiplication: Properties of Multiplication
Some important properties of multiplication are:
1. Commutative property: The order in which two numbers are multiplied does not affect the result. In other words, a x b = b x a
2. Associative property: The grouping of three or more numbers being multiplied does not affect the result. In other words, (a x b) x c = a x (b x c)
3. Distributive property: When a number is multiplied by a sum or difference of two or more numbers, it can be distributed to each term inside the parentheses separately. In other words, a x (b + c) = a x b + a x c
